Goway Offers Total-Eclipse Viewing on New 2027 Egypt Itinerary

by Bruce Parkinson  August 28, 2026
Goway Offers Total-Eclipse Viewing on New 2027 Egypt Itinerary

Tailor-made travel specialist Goway has announced a new trip offering travellers the opportunity to see a total solar eclipse from the heart of Egypt next year.  

The operator’s new 10-day Chasing Totality: Egypt & Red Sea Solar Eclipse combines one of the world’s most spectacular natural phenomena, the total solar eclipse on August 2, 2027, with the historical wonders of Egypt — the land that pioneered sun worship in the ancient world. 

Goway’s new itinerary includes:

  • An exclusive total solar eclipse viewing event from Akassia Marsa Alam’s Roman-style theatre, with over five minutes of total darkness. 
  • 5 nights at a deluxe resort in Marsa Alam on the Red Sea. 
  • 4 nights at a deluxe hotel in Cairo. 
  • Egyptologist-led tours of the Grand Egyptian Museum, the Pyramids of Giza, and Khan el-Khalili Bazaar among other Cairo landmarks.

“While many Nile cruise eclipse programs are already sold out or offer extremely limited availability, Goway has developed an exciting alternative on the Red Sea coast that travel advisors can sell with confidence,” says Bronwyn Hodge, Goway’s VP, Africa & Middle East. 

“Rather than treating the eclipse as a standalone sightseeing event, Goway’s Chasing Totality: Egypt & Red Sea Solar Eclipse combines Cairo’s iconic landmarks with five nights at a Red Sea resort and an exclusive hosted viewing experience at Akassia Marsa Alam’s Roman-style theatre. The result is a more relaxed and immersive way to experience this extraordinary event and explore the wonders of Egypt.” 

Goway has secured a limited allocation for this highly anticipated event and suggests travel advisors should book early.
